Thomas Bryant Cotton was born on May 13, 1977, in Dardanelle, Arkansas. [1] His father, Thomas Leonard "Len" Cotton, was a district supervisor in the Arkansas Department of Health, and his mother, Avis (née Bryant) Cotton, was a schoolteacher who later became principal of their district's middle school.
